The three-baryon potential
Abstract
Using a three-baryon potential having a spin-independent dispersive and a two-pion exchange components, realistic variational Monte Carlo calculations have been performed for the -seperation energy for He. A relationship between strengths associated with both pieces of force giving exact experimental -seperation energy has been obtained which then combined with our previous study on O hypernucleus determines a unique and acceptable set of strength parameters for potential. The force is found important for the core polarization.
